#7e572f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e572f is composed of 49.4% red, 34.1%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 30.4 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 33.9%. #7e572f color hex could be obtained by blending #fcae5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#7e572f color description : Dark moderate orange.
#7e572f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e572f has RGB values of R:126, G:87,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.63,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8279855.
